Responsibilities
* Analyze and optimise performance per watt of next‑generation solutions using simulation, emulation, and modelling.
* Collaborate cross‑functional teams: design, verification, architecture, software, pre‑post silicon test.
* Build and innovate new processes; ensure customer PPA requirements measured and analysed; creatively exceed.
* Develop RTL simulator/emulator workloads for power estimation; create visualisations of hardware power signature; review quality and accuracy of EDA power analysis flows and evaluate new tools and methodologies.
Required Skills and Experience
* Experience in power analysis, modelling, or transferable skills from design, implementation, verification backgrounds.
* Understanding of low power design features and techniques (clock and power gating, voltage/frequency scaling, memory/logic retention).
* Ability to balance trade‑offs between power, performance, and area.
* Verilog/SystemVerilog experience.
* Experience using power analysis tools (PowerPro, PrimePower, PowerArtist) or power delivery and signoff tools.
* Knowledge of physical implementation flow from RTL through synthesis, place & route to STA.
